#B990B7 Hex Color Code

#B990B7

The Hexadecimal Color #B990B7 is a contrast shade of Dark Gray. #B990B7 RGB value is rgb(185, 144, 183). RGB Color Model of #B990B7 consists of 72% red, 56% green and 71% blue. HSL color Mode of #B990B7 has 303°(degrees) Hue, 23% Saturation and 65% Lightness. #B990B7 color has an wavelength of 429.22222n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#B990B7 is #CC99CC.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#B990B7 is #B8B. The Closest Color to #B990B7 is #A9A9A9. Official Name of #B990B7 Hex Code is Amethyst Smoke.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#B990B7 is 0 Cyan 22 Magenta 1 Yellow 27 Black and #B990B7 CMY is 0, 22, 1.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#B990B7 is hsl(303,23,65,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(303, 22, 73).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#B990B7 is 38.53, 33.68, 49.26.
Hex8 Value of #B990B7 is #B990B7FF. Decimal Value of #B990B7 is 12161207 and Octal Value of #B990B7 is 56310267. Binary Value of #B990B7 is 10111001, 10010000, 10110111 and Android of #B990B7 is 4290351287 / 0xffb990b7.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#B990B7 is 0.317, 0.277, 0.277 and YIQ Color Space of #B990B7 is 160.705, 11.9012, 20.8083.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#B990B7 is 34.7, 30.36, 49.02.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#B990B7 is 64.71, 22.17, -14.38.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#B990B7 is 64.71, 21.06, -25.24.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#B990B7 is 64.71, 26.43, 327.03. Hunter Lab variable of #B990B7 is 58.03, 16.95, -9.7.

Various Color Shades of #B990B7

To get 25% Saturated #B990B7 Color, you need to convert the hex color #B990B7 to the HSL (Hue, Saturation, Lightness) color space, increase the saturation value by 25%, and then convert it back to the hex color. To desaturate a color by 25%, we need to reduce its saturation level while keeping the same hue and lightness. Saturation represents the intensity or vividness of a color. A 100% saturation means the color is fully vivid, while a 0% saturation results in a shade of gray. To make a color 25% darker or 25% lighter, you need to reduce the intensity of each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components by 25% or increase it to 25%. Inverting a #B990B7 hex color involves converting each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components to their complementary values. The complementary color is found by subtracting each component's value from the maximum value of 255.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#B990B7

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
